Ticket: FIELD-2281 — Expired credentials blocking offline sync

For the weekly sync: the Heronpath field-survey app's offline mode stopped reconciling on Monday because the cached sync token expired while crews were out of coverage. Surveys queued locally are intact, but uploads fail silently until re-auth. We've extended token lifetime to 30 days and reissued credentials. The replacement key for the internal sync service follows.

service key, fafog-fahaf: vxb3-x55

## Broker upgrade (Larkspur 3.x)

Drain consumers before upgrading. Stop all Penwick plugin workers, snapshot queue state, then roll brokers one node at a time. Plugins built against the 2.x wire protocol must rebuild against the 3.x SDK; no shims. Verify with `larkctl verify` after each node. Reconnecting workers need the new broker credential, so append this line to your env file:

secret setting of yafof-tawep: RELAY_SECRET8=8abb5772

☐ Key Ceremony Step 4 — Cold storage archive unseal

For the reviewer: this step releases the archive keys used to seal the Quillhaven cold-storage buckets before long-term retention. Verify both custodians are present, the bucket manifest hash matches the ceremony record, and the previous archive epoch was closed cleanly. Note any discrepancy before proceeding; do not continue on a mismatch. With checks complete, unseal the archive keyring using the recovery passphrase below.

unlock words, yahif-yajop: framir-silir-gorvan-gorir-belius-tamwyn

## Handover: Stagegrid Seat-Map Renderer

For the sync: I'm handing the Stagegrid renderer to Perrin. The SVG layout for the Varnhall Theatre balcony is correct now; the earlier overlap bug came from stale zone caches, and the fix is merged. Remaining work is the accessibility overlay and the pricing-tier legend. The render service account locked itself last week after the credential rotation, so Perrin will need to run the recovery flow on the Stagegrid admin console; when prompted, enter the passphrase that follows.

strongbox words: sorir-belvan-rusix-ulays-ralmir-praix-eliir-tamax-praael-druael-julir-tamius-jorir